by Dotti Mon Apr 05, 2010 3:27 pm
Another scam, I'm afraid.

Language is African
44-70 number = redirect number, used by people pretending to be in UK when they are not.

qatar-airways.co.cc = known scammer site, used in several scams already, currently being addressed. In the meantime any email containing a reference to qatar-airways.co.cc should be considered a scam.
